What will I learn?

This NDNA online course will help you become more confident and involved in helping children develop their maths skills. The course shows how easy Maths can be incorporated into play.

Key topics include:

  • Key theories and research relating to mathematical development
  • Brain and cognitive development in relation to mathematical development
  • Relate mathematics to all areas of learning and development and the EYFS
  • Understand schemas and mathematical development
  • Observe, plan and assess for children’s mathematical development
  • Implement maths into everyday life
  • How parents can support mathematical development
